Which colleges in Florida offer good psychology programs?

I'm really interested in psychology and considering colleges in Florida. Can anyone recommend some schools with strong psychology departments or any unique opportunities for psychology students in Florida?

3 months ago

Several colleges and universities in Florida offer great psychology programs where you can further your interest.

University of Florida (UF) is a top choice when it comes to psychology programs. Their Psychology Department offers a Bachelor of Science in Psychology where students have the chance to do research in various areas like cognitive neuroscience, developmental psychology, and social psychology. UF holds a high placement rate of graduates in professional settings and postgraduate programs.

Another option would be Florida State University (FSU). FSU's Department of Psychology is well-known for its comprehensive curriculum and research opportunities, which include the chance to work on faculty-led projects. FSU offers multiple tracks within their psychology program, allowing students to focus in an area of interest such as clinical psychology, cognitive psychology, developmental psychology, or others.

You might also want to check out the University of South Florida (USF). The USF College of Arts and Sciences offers a well-rounded psychology program. They offer a number of specializations and research opportunities, allowing students to tailor their studies to their specific interests within psychology.

The University of Miami (UM) is another school to consider. UM's Department of Psychology is renowned for its strong faculty, research opportunities, and internships. Their curriculum is designed to impart a comprehensive understanding of the field, preparing students for a variety of career paths in psychology.

Lastly, Nova Southeastern University (NSU) offers a unique opportunity with their Psychology Honors Program. This program offers select psychology majors the opportunity to work closely with faculty on research projects, get hands-on experiences in psychology, and receive guidance about graduate school and career options.

Remember, while the reputation of a school's psychology program is important, consider other factors such as the campus culture, surrounding community, faculty, facility, et cetera, as you make your college decision.
